2.4-GHz ISM Antennas Suit M2M Applications

Two ceramic antennas are the newest entries to Pulse Engineering Inc.’s range of 2.4-GHz ISM antennas. The two ceramic antennas expand the company’s range of products suitable for ISM bands of 315 MHz, 433 MHz, 868 MHz, 915 MHz, 2.4 GHz, 5 GHz, and GPRS (see the figure).

The antennas are used for machine-to-machine (M2M) applications in devices such as data loggers, remote controls, tracking devices, tags, monitoring devices, automated meter readers, tire pressure monitoring devices, remote keyless entry systems, and many others that depend on reliable wireless connectivity.
